Dancehall Queen Style is a Jamaican dance fashion which became popular in the 1990s through music videos and The Grind show on MTV. The video takes elements from dancehall culture and traditional Sámi outfit.

													Jenni Hiltunen lives and works in Helsinki. She graduated as a Master of Arts from the Finnish Academy of Fine Arts in 2007 and as a visual artist from the Turku Art Academy in 2004. Her works explore the ambience of the present time and the “posing culture” created by social media and the Internet and the world of entertainment are recurring themes in her art. Hiltunen's works have been presented in solo and group exhibitions in Helsinki, Milan, New York and London.
